الإصدارات الجديدة من I2P anonymous network 1.7.0 and i2pd 2.41 C ++ client

تم إصدار الشبكة المجهولة I2P 1.7.0 وعميل C++ i2pd 2.41.0. دعونا نتذكر أن I2P عبارة عن شبكة موزعة مجهولة متعددة الطبقات تعمل فوق الإنترنت العادي، وتستخدم التشفير من طرف إلى طرف بشكل نشط، مما يضمن عدم الكشف عن هويته والعزلة. تم إنشاء الشبكة في وضع P2P ويتم تشكيلها بفضل الموارد (النطاق الترددي) التي يوفرها مستخدمو الشبكة، مما يجعل من الممكن الاستغناء عن استخدام الخوادم المُدارة مركزيًا (تعتمد الاتصالات داخل الشبكة على استخدام أنفاق مشفرة أحادية الاتجاه بين المشاركون والأقران).

على شبكة I2P ، يمكنك إنشاء مواقع ويب ومدونات بشكل مجهول ، وإرسال رسائل فورية ورسائل بريد إلكتروني ، وتبادل الملفات ، وتنظيم شبكات P2P. لبناء واستخدام شبكات مجهولة لتطبيقات خادم العميل (مواقع الويب والمحادثات) وتطبيقات P2P (تبادل الملفات والعملات المشفرة) ، يتم استخدام عملاء I2P. عميل I2P الأساسي مكتوب بلغة Java ويمكن تشغيله على مجموعة واسعة من الأنظمة الأساسية مثل Windows و Linux و macOS و Solaris وما إلى ذلك. I2pd هو تطبيق C ++ مستقل لعميل I2P ويتم توزيعه بموجب ترخيص BSD معدل.

من بين التغييرات:

  • ينفذ التطبيق الصغير لعلبة النظام عرض الرسائل المنبثقة.
  • تمت إضافة محرر ملفات تورنت جديد إلى i2psnark.
  • تمت إضافة دعم علامات IRCv2 إلى i3ptunnel.
  • تم تقليل حمل وحدة المعالجة المركزية (CPU) عند استخدام نقل NTCP2.
  • أدت عمليات التثبيت الجديدة إلى إزالة واجهة برمجة تطبيقات BOB، التي تم إهمالها منذ فترة طويلة (تحتفظ عمليات التثبيت الحالية بدعم BOB، ولكن يتم تشجيع المستخدمين على الانتقال إلى بروتوكول SAMv3).
  • كود محسّن للبحث عن المعلومات وحفظها في قاعدة البيانات. تمت إضافة الحماية ضد اختيار أقرانهم ذوي الأداء المنخفض عند تثبيت الأنفاق. تم تنفيذ العمل لتحسين موثوقية الشبكة في حالة وجود أجهزة توجيه بها مشكلات أو ضارة.
  • في i2pd 2.41، تم إصلاح المشكلة التي أدت إلى انخفاض موثوقية الشبكة.
  • تم نشر شبكة اختبار منفصلة لاختبار الأنفاق بين أجهزة التوجيه القائمة على i2pd وJava I2P. ستسمح لنا شبكة الاختبار بتحديد مشكلات قابلية التشغيل البيني بين i2pd وJava I2P أثناء اختبار ما قبل النشر.
  • لقد بدأ تطوير وسيلة نقل UDP جديدة "SSU2"، والتي ستؤدي إلى تحسين الأداء والأمان بشكل كبير. سيسمح لنا تنفيذ SSU2 أيضًا بتحديث حزمة التشفير بالكامل والتخلص من خوارزمية ElGamal البطيئة جدًا (للتشفير من طرف إلى طرف، سيتم استخدام مجموعة ECIES-X25519-AEAD-Ratchet بدلاً من ElGamal/AES+ علامة الجلسة).

المصدر: opennet.ru

إضافة تعليق